    Crusty reacted to Ockham's Spoon in New Talents thread   
    I see the primary use of the proposed Dilettante talent as a boost for someone with Cramming, which effectively allows you to get better than 8- on any skill in a short time, which sort of circumvents one of the primary restrictions on Cramming.  I would consider allowing it for some characters (like a mentalist that can absorb skills), but probably not for a heroic level campaign.

    Crusty reacted to Lee in Str as Power with Continuing Charges   
    I'd say that the STR increase granted by the charge(s) does not cost END to use, but the base STR still costs END. So, if you have a 10 STR and a power that gives you +40 STR on continuing charges, you could use 50 STR where the +40 costs 0 END (because of the charges) and 2 (or 1 I don't remember) END for the base 10 STR.
